The everyday tassa group is as follows: the guide tassa participant is known as the "cutter" or "Slice-person". The cutter plays the principle, pulsating rhythm, or taal, or hand. The next tassa participant is known as the "fulley" or "fuller", as their purpose is to help make the rhythm or "taal" sound a lot more whole. The fulley plays a gradual rhythm typically a simplified Edition of the most crucial hand but in similar metre and mode.

Played through the use of a bamboo keep on with bare hands, the Assamese dhol is produced up of a wood barrel Together with the finishes protected primarily with animal hide (as opposed to the rest of the Indian subcontinent, where it could be a synthetic skin as well), that may either be stretched or loosened by tightening the interwoven straps. The dhol player is termed Dhulia and the professional in dhol is termed Ojah (Assamese: ওজা).
